actually no I would not since it could be lots of things making this happen-------bendix and horn work opposite. One takes air to lock the other takes air to unlock. With that being said you might need to switch binary/trianry switches after you switched them to be the same.



I do away with the ones that are locked in at startup until the truck builds air-------------we are just careful to make sure the AC high pressure switches function in these trucks since high pressure under the right conditions can take place before enough air is built to get things locked up


so they put in a high pressure to engage the fan

but with no air pressure in the truck if they would just put a high pressure switch to stop the compressor

the rad fan not having air would then have a "safety "
